How they compare
Kuwait currently reports 100.0% against 100.0% in Mozambique,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 19 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Kuwait ahead.
Kuwait ranks 1st and Mozambique ranks 1st of 181 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Kuwait averaged higher in 1 and Mozambique in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Kuwait | Mozambique |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 100.0% | 64.8% | 35.2% | Kuwait |
| 2010s | 56.9% | 94.5% | 37.6% | Mozambique |
| 2020s | 76.8% | 99.4% | 22.6% | Mozambique |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
